Refrigerated Containers
Refrigerated Containers (also known as reefers) are used by a variety of industries to transport temperature-sensitive products over long distances. From catering companies that provide cooked meals to research labs that are transporting blood plasma, refrigerated containers can be customized with features like remote monitoring and backup power options.
A box that is refrigerated will ensure that your goods arrive in perfect condition. Energy efficiency is a key focus for modern refrigeration systems and insulation that is of high-quality.
Customization
When refrigerated containers are concerned, each decision you make clears the way for the safety and security of your cargo. Your thoughtful choices will ensure that your goods remain at their top by making sure you select the right size options for different types of shipments, and high-tech features to elevate cold chain management.
For instance, choosing containers that are sized to your product's volume minimizes temperature fluctuations and improves efficiency in energy use. The type of insulation is also important. Both foam and vacuum insulation panels are available, but the choice will depend on your requirements. Foam is more affordable, but vacuum insulation panels have superior thermal resistance.
In the world of reefer technology, using IoT capabilities allows for continuous monitoring and alerts to make sure your shipment is safe throughout its journey. These digital advances also increase efficiency in operations and transparency in supply chain.
A specialized refrigeration unit can be engineered to meet the specific requirements of your products and guarantee their welfare during long voyages like for live cargo or pharmaceuticals. These specialized containers may feature redundancy systems to prevent any unexpected system failures. They may also be outfitted with materials that meet the highest standards of the pharmaceutical industry or ensure a safe and healthy environment for transit for livestock.
Other innovations include airflow vents or fresh air ducts that manage the inside atmosphere and keep it stable. These piping systems remove gases like ethylene that accelerates the ripening of fruit and promote an uniform distribution of temperature throughout the container. Additionally, a built-in drainage system helps prevent the accumulation of water and insect infestation.
Energy Efficiency
Refrigerated Containers provide a secure and safe place to store temperature-sensitive cargo. They are able to protect pharmaceuticals and premium food items. They are made with advanced controls and a high-quality insulation to keep internal temperatures steady. They also come with enhanced security features that can safeguard your product from vandalism and theft. Some containers are designed to be eco sustainable and utilize renewable sources of energy which makes them a viable option for businesses.
While refrigeration systems are crucial to ensure the quality of cargo, they also consume lots of energy. This is particularly the case when there are multiple containers that are stored on the same vessel or at the terminal. This power consumption is high and can be offset by using refrigerated containers equipped with automated temperature management systems. These systems monitor and adjust the container's temperature in accordance with the surrounding temperature and can result in significant savings.
Modern refrigerated containers (reefers) focus on energy efficiency and utilize advanced cooling and insulation techniques to reduce the power consumption. They are also typically equipped with diesel generators, which can be used in places without access to electrical power. This allows them to continue to work in transit or when stationary power is unavailable.
A significant proportion of the power consumption of refrigerated containers can be attributed by the exchange of heat between the container's interior and environment through insulation that is cold-resistant. Its share reaches 35 to 85% in the cooling mode, and up to 50% in the heating mode (Filina and Filin 2004).

Maintenance
Refrigerated Containers are a great way to transport temperature-sensitive cargo, but they require proper maintenance and cleaning to ensure optimal performance. Some of the best ways to ensure that your refrigerated containers remain in good working order include routine calibration, power maintenance, insulation maintenance, and door maintenance.
Temperature Monitoring
Refrigerated Conversions Containers are able to monitor temperatures in the container remotely, ensuring that they remain within a certain range throughout their journey. This feature also gives logistics professionals detailed data logs for quality assurance purposes. Specialized containers for reefers also come with backup power sources to ensure that temperature control systems aren't interrupted due to power outages.
Cooling
Refrigerated containers use an airflow system to distribute cold air throughout the interior, ensuring the cargo at optimum temperature. This helps remove moisture, gases and ethylene produced by fruits and veggies, which can lead to spoilage.
It is important to inspect regularly the insulated piping in reefers for leaks. Using an halide and soap lamp or electronic leak detector can aid in identifying the cause of any issues. It is also recommended to inspect the inside of the refrigerator unit regularly to see if there is any accumulation of ice. This can have a negative impact on the capacity of the container's cooling.
A major component of the cooling process is the compressor, which is responsible for regulating and circulating the refrigerant inside the refrigeration system. Regular calibrations for the compressor can improve efficiency and reduce energy consumption.
Insulation is a crucial component of reefer containers that are specially designed, as it minimizes the heat exchange between the interior and exterior. The highest-quality insulation materials, such as polyurethane foam are used to maximize efficiency in thermal efficiency and ensure consistent temperatures throughout the Shipping Containers journey.
The final step to maintain the integrity of the refrigerated container is to clean it regularly. This involves cleaning the interior of the container and wiping off all surfaces. This is especially important in areas where the seals on doors may be affected, such as under and behind them.
It is also an excellent idea to re-paint the exterior of a refrigerated container regularly. Use marine-grade paint to shield the container from rust and ensure it is in good condition. It is also important to repair minor dents that may affect the integrity of seals.
